### Step 4: Configure the env file

BigDiff chunks files over 500 MB and streams hunks to the browser, so it needs a scratch bucket and a signing credential — heads up, reviewer, that's the sensitive part. Copy `env.example` to `.env`, set `SCRATCH_BUCKET` and `CHUNK_SIZE_MB` (defaults are fine), and confirm the file isn't tracked by git. Then add the bucket signing secret on the next line, exactly as shown below.

env line for fafof-fahag: LEDGER_TOKEN5=f8790

Crashlane Pipeline — Environment Variables

The Crashlane ingest worker for the Pebblemark mobile app reads its config from /srv/crashlane/worker.env. Set CL_QUEUE_NAME and CL_SYMBOLICATE=true before each release cut. The release manager should also confirm the upload credential for the symbol store is present, which belongs on the line immediately after this one.

sealed setting: ARCHIVE_KEY3=8d0

# Break-Glass: Catalog Cache Invalidation

Scope: the Pinrow product catalog at Veldstone Retail. If stale prices persist after a purge and the Hollowmere invalidation queue is wedged, use break-glass to flush the edge tier directly. Contractors: get verbal sign-off from the catalog lead first. Steps: open the Hollowmere admin shell, select emergency-flush, confirm the tenant, and run it once — repeated flushes thrash the origin. Access is logged and expires after 20 minutes. Unseal the admin shell with the passphrase below.

recovery phrase for kahop-tajog: istix-casvan

Alert: Calendar Sync Conflict — Tandemly Scheduler. Since Tuesday's deploy, recurring events edited in the Quillboard client are generating duplicate entries when synced back through the Tandemly bridge. Roughly 3% of sync jobs are affected. A dedupe patch is in review; until then, conflicted events are quarantined rather than written through. Affected workspaces are listed in the incident doc. Report new occurrences to the address below.

escalation mailbox, bafog-fafog: ulador@paliqlabs.internal